Brief summary
This study investigates the role of Magnetic Resonance Imaging (MRI) in detecting Ductal Carcinoma in situ (DCIS) in high-risk breast cancer patients.
Detailed description
Improved detection rates of DCIS in high-risk patients. Enhanced diagnostic accuracy, reducing false positives and negatives. Ductal Carcinoma in situ (DCIS) is a non-invasive breast cancer where abnormal cells are confined to the milk ducts. The Breast Imaging Reporting and Data System (BI-RADS) is a standardized scoring system used to classify breast imaging findings. Scores range from 0 (incomplete) to 6 (known biopsy-proven malignancy).

Eligibility
Inclusion criteria
* High-risk breast cancer patients with a family history of breast cancer or genetic predispositions (e.g., BRCA mutations). * Patients aged 30-65 years. * Patients willing to undergo breast MRI screening for DCIS detection.
Exclusion criteria
* Patients with contraindications to MRI imaging (e.g., pacemakers, claustrophobia). * Patients with a history of prior breast surgery or interventions that may interfere with imaging interpretation.
